Free Bob Records / FBR 1-120794-2-2 Review: The first song of this show was Jokerman. It exists on tape, and there is plenty of room to have included it, so its absence is a mystery. The cover leaves a lot to be desired in my mind. I've never been a fan of Dylan caricatures... especially as unflattering of ones as this. The aesthetics are original... but too over the top. The set includes an odd bonus as well. The seven song encore was taken from the Crystal Cat release of the show from Sept. 16, 2000 in Aberdeen, Scotland. http://www.bobsboots.com/CDs/cd-l25.html cdr trade < XLD < flac apa05
